April 22, 2018April 22, 2018 LSU Football Report Justin McMillan has best spring game, but LSU quarterback competition far from over LSU football coach Ed Orgeron opened up his post-spring game press conference with an I-told-you-so statement. “I think you’ve seen tonight what I’ve been talking about with all the quarterbacks,” Orgeron said. “Sometimes they’re doing well, sometimes they’re not.” It was that kind of night for LSU’s quarterbacks on Saturday night (April 21) in the Tigers’ annual spring game.
